Ligularia przewalskii is a spectacular shade perennial, prized for its deeply cut, dark green foliage, almost architectural. In summer, it produces tall, slender, bright golden-yellow flower spikes that rise above the foliage, creating a striking vertical effect.

It develops a dense and structured habit, perfect for partially shaded flowerbeds, woodland gardens, or arrangements near a water feature. Its textured foliage adds contrast and character throughout the season.

Very hardy and vigorous, Ligularia prefers rich, cool to moist, and well-drained soils. It performs best in partial shade, especially in regions with hot summer sun. It is also deer-resistant, an important advantage for Quebec gardens.

Features

  • Botanical name: Ligularia przewalskii

  • Type: Shade perennial

  • Bloom time: July to August

  • Color: Golden yellow

  • Height: 120 to 150 cm

  • Spread: 75 to 90 cm

  • Exposure: Partial shade

  • Watering: Regular (cool to moist soil)

  • Soil: Rich and well-drained

  • Hardiness: Zone 3

  • Assets: Architectural foliage, bright vertical bloom, deer-resistant
